Can I use this tool for professional electrical work?

This tool creates basic wiring diagrams for planning and documentation purposes. While useful for initial design concepts and educational materials, professional electrical work requires certified CAD software and should always be reviewed by licensed electricians. The diagrams generated here are not substitutes for professional electrical engineering or code compliance verification.

What electrical components are available in the component library?

The tool includes common residential and light commercial components: standard outlets (GFCI and regular), light switches (single-pole, three-way), various light fixtures, junction boxes, electrical panels, and basic symbols for wire connections. Components follow standard electrical schematic symbols for clear communication with electricians and inspectors.
